Customs, smugglers in gun duel in Ogun

Men of the Nigeria Customs invaded Ipokia community, a border town in Ogun State in the early hours of Thursday, shooting sporadically and injuring few people.

Our correspondent gathered that the custom men who drove into Iwaye, palace of the Onipokia of Ipokia land, Oba Raufu Adeole, where they injured a number of people, were on the trail of some rice smugglers.

Residents were thrown into panic as many run into bushes and canals.

A woman was seen running with her nine-day-old baby in escape for her dear live.

Some residents who spoke with our correspondent condemned the actions of the Custom describing it as unbecoming, especially at a time when people were still celebrating Eid-il-fitri.

It was learnt that the Customs officer were chasing rice transporters who they suspected to be smugglers.

Youths in Ipokia were said to have stood against the Customs, saying it was an aberration to shoot sporadically within a highly populated Iwaye compound, where the Oba’s palace is.

Many parked vehicles and Okadas were said to have been vandalised by the Customs as they shot at them.

A young man was said to have been whisked away by the Customs Officer.

All efforts to get the reaction of the Custom image maker in the state proved abortive as he was not picking calls put across to him.
